    We also tired of the poly smell in August! Now we never run the pink stuff
    into the water tanks or water heater. Bypass the WH by disonnecting the
    intake and outflow and connect together as a bypass. Then drain the heater
    and call it good. We drain both water tanks and leave the outflow
    disconnected all winter. We run potable AF through the water lines and leave
    it in over winter. Very easy to flush just the lines in the spring and no
    more AF smell. Works well at least in central Chesapeake area.
